Debbie Huggins Marriage to Phil McGraw

Debbie was the first wife of Dr. Phil, as he is fondly known. The couple met when they were just 20 years of age and fell in love before tying the knot in 1970 in the Roeland Park Southridge Presbyterian Church. Apparently both Debbie and Dr. Phil hailed from Kansas City, where the latter spent over a decade playing football. Debbie married Dr. Phil at 20 years of age and although as a boyfriend Phil was known to be nice and loving, this allegedly changed after the two married. Phil is said to have wanted his wife to maintain her physique, and therefore asked her to start lifting weights in order to ensure she looked good. Phil was insecure about his wife’s looks and was constantly worried about what people would say if they saw him with an unattractive woman.

The couple divorced in 1973, just three years after they married. When Newsweek interviewed the couple, they talked about their failed marriage – Dr. Phil confessed that he was a huge football player who fell in love with a beautiful cheerleader, Debbie. However, he said that the union did not work out without offering any more details. Debbie, on the other side, was willing to open up and share her side of the story. According to her, Dr. Phil was a dominating person who always made her feel like a very tightly coiled spring. Each time they would interact, Debbie felt like a wound up person. Although she confessed that everything was fine at the beginning, that changed and she felt like she was in a mental prison. Dr. Phil would cheat on Debbie with other women, and each time she tried to confront him, he would become defensive and tell her that it was the norm.

Even before the two finalized their divorce, Dr. Phil was already dating Robin Jameson who he later married in 1976 and had children with. There is no news of Debbie ever remarrying.
